MBE & WBE Self-Evaluation for DHCD OneStop Submissions

On January 6, 2022, CEDAC hosted a webinar to review the Self-Evaluation Form for MBE & WBE Utilization which was included in DHCD’s 2022-2023 Qualified Allocation Plan.  Developers requesting funding from DHCD are now required to submit this form along with their OneStop funding application.

Maximizing Participation of MBES IN Affordable Housing Construction

On March 8, 2022, CEDAC partnered with Travis Watson, Director of Racial Equity and Community Engagement at MHIC, to host a webinar with the aim to equip developers with strategies and best practices to increase the participation of MBEs and workers of color during the direct construction phase of an affordable housing project.

CBH Design Requirements: An Update

After 15 successful years of the Community Based Housing program, CEDAC, DHCD and MRC have worked with Davis Square Architects to update and clarify the CBH design guidelines. Watch a recording of our training from October 6, 2020 to learn about these changes as well as other guidance on CBH design and construction.

SUMMARY OF UPDATED FCF-DDS DESIGN GUIDELINES

CEDAC, EOHLC and DDS, in collaboration with Resolution Architects, have made significant updates to the FCF-DDS design guidelines based on feedback from the stakeholder community. Watch this webinar from December 2023 to learn about the changes. The updated design guidelines can be found here.
